x5 e70 2008 INNER TAIL LIGHT on trunk flickering
hi,
i have a issue with my x5 e70 2008 INNER TAIL LIGHT on trunk flickering, I called the stealer and they said i have to change the hole light for some reason .... does not make sense to me .... Any1 know if i can just simply change the light bulb or is there fix for this as i think it is a LED. Also if any1 knows about a repair kit or maybe knows what has to be repaired. You have to remove the inner panel on the tailgate and check on the connector, I will guess its corroded by moisture...what I will suggest is to remove the whole tailight and clean the connector and make sure replace the tailight gasket.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=KGZ3GxH0Fs0 |

Here's a BMW bulletin on that point: https://drive.google.com/file/d/0B1e...ew?usp=sharing
If cleaning won't solve it, you may have to replace the all assembly for real since the LEDs are not sold as a replaceable item. |

UPDATE:
just got back from garage and yes the complete light has to be changed as we tried cleaning trying to safe it ,..no moisture or wet inside at all just defect of light. thanks every1 |
